Research Abstract |
Olivine-type LiFePO_4 is one of the promising cathode materials for Li-ion batteries, but the relationship between its electrochemical properties and structure is unclear. In this study, LiFePO_4 particles were synthesized through liquid and solid processes, and their charging/discharging properties and the Fe chemical state were investigated In-situ X-ray absorption spectroscopy at the Fe-K edge for obtaining the chemical variation of LiFePO_4 particles during charge/discharge cycles. The chemical state of Fe in LiFePO_4 particles has been found to correlate with the charging and discharging process. The effect of heat treatment was examined with respect to the structure and electrochemical properties of LiFePO_4 particles prepared by the polyol process. The appropriate heat treatment showed the improvement of their charging and discharging capacity.
